Chiru: “Prabhas, Followed By Arjun, Tarak, Charan & Yash”

There are several opinions about what a ‘pan India film’ is and who are pan India heroes. But then, if it comes from the megamouth, surely those are golden words that could be etched into history forever. And last night, Megastar Chiranjeevi did it, as he sums up his feelings about pan India films and pan India stars.

Back in the 80s, Megastar Chiru felt sad while receiving National Award that the walls of the auditorium are not even decorated with a single Telugu or any South film poster.

And for that reason, today Chiru is elated that Superstar and legendary director SS Rajamouli crafted a way to showcase the world what pan India cinema is. He hailed the RRR director as a demi-god who should be remembered forever in the history of Telugu cinema.

Later Chiru stated that South films have become the new address for pan India movies. He praised the likes of Allu Arjun for Pushpa, Tarak and Charan for RRR, and Yash for KGF. Later Chiranjeevi also added, “Of course, Prabhas went into that spot way ahead than others”. The matinee idol also complimented Sukumar and Prashanth Neel for making such larger than life films that will be adored by the whole of Indians.
